Process child arrangement applications quicker and reduce times between hearings
Rejected
16 signatures
What the petition asks
Process child arrangement applications and arrange first hearings to within 28 days of submission. Also reduce waiting times between court hearings to shorten the time children are kept from having contact with one or both parents.
When a parent makes a family court application they are often left waiting for considerable amounts of time for a first court hearing and in between hearings. These lengthy court processes have an adverse effect on the child/ren's welfare and development. This in turn has a detrimental effect on the mental health of the child/ren and the parent. Being without a parent for such a substantial amount of time causes significant damage to the relationship between them and the parent.
Why it was rejected
It asked for something that is not the responsibility of the UK Government or Parliament.
We can't accept your petition because the UK Government and Parliament aren't responsible for the issue you raise. This is a matter for the courts.
